CFR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2014 in Review

319 of the 3,750 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cullen/Frost Bankers (CFR) for Q4 2014, worth a combined $3.41B — down 9.1% from $3.76B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 59 funds opened new CFR positions and 21 closed out — a net gain of 38 holders — while 121 added to existing stakes and 95 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$47.5M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, exiting entirely with an estimated $130M sold.
